Confidence in Defending
Defenders and attackers are balanced, creating a realistic and enjoyable
experience when trying to regain possession of the ball.
-
Defensive Agility brings balance in movement between
attackers and defenders, driven by more than 25 gameplay feature
changes to defender locomotion.
-
Defend as a Unit injects intelligence and
positional-awareness into players so they can better decide between
marking an opponent and covering dangerous space.
-
New Tackling Fundamentals offers new behaviors like fake
and standing tackles, as well as full-body challenges and the ability
to bridge out of sliding tackles when caught out of position.
Control in Midfield
In midfield, two game-changing features make the battle in the middle of
the pitch as important as it is in real football.
-
Interception Intelligence gives players the smarts to
close passing channels and shut down options.
-
Passing with Purpose offers a new driven pass to play
sharp, incisive passes so you can find teammates with precision.
Moments of Magic
FIFA 16 gives fans the tools they need to create thrilling
moments in attack.
-
No Touch Dribbling gives players the option to let the
ball run to buy time, create separation, feint, and blow by the
defender in the final third. A feature inspired by the motion capture
of Lionel Messi, it changes the way players attack.
-
Clinical Finishing provides variety in shooting and more
exciting goals than ever before.

Compete at a Higher Level
Regardless of skill level, everyone will have a chance to Compete at a
Higher Level by utilizing the EA SPORTS FIFA Trainer, a ground-breaking
in-game training system which uses the context of the game to recommend
options to the player. Fans can now learn as they play with an optional
graphic overlay (HUD) which prompts them with gameplay options depending
on their position on the pitch and Trainer level. The trainer
recommendations will progress as the level of the trainer increases,
which can be set to automatic or controlled manually. Basic commands get
you started, while deeper hints will improve the game of the most
skilled fans.
New Ways to Play
With all New Ways to Play, FIFA 16 will feature 12 Women’s
National Teams for the first time in franchise history. Teams from
Australia, Brazil, Canada, China, England, France, Germany, Italy,
Mexico, Spain, Sweden, and the United States of America will all
represent their respective federations in several FIFA 16 game
modes including Kick Off, an Offline Tournament, as well as Online***

A New Way to Play On the Go
For those who want an authentic football experience on the go, EA SPORTS
announced a brand new mobile game in development – EA SPORTS FIFA.
Launching later this year as a free download on the App StoreSM and
Google Play™, the next generation FIFA for mobile harnesses the
increased power of new devices to deliver stunning console-quality
gameplay to phones and tablets. Fans will enjoy authentic football on
their phone or tablet devices, with enhanced hybrid touch controls, new
skill moves, and for the first time ever on mobile, player celebrations.
